1. Avoid Blockages
One of the most obvious factors for cleaning your bathroom drains pipes each month is to prevent obstructions. A lot more goes down the drain than you would believe-- skin flakes, eyelashes, dirt, and hair. All of these particles collect and eventually cause clogs. Even a minor blockage can make your sink or shower essentially unusable. When you tidy your drains pipes frequently, you will not wind up with deep blockages that require strong chemicals and expert devices. While you can clean your restroom drains by yourself, we advise that you call a plumbing professional to expertly clean your drains pipes a couple of times annually.

2. Prevent Bad Odors
There is absolutely nothing more embarrassing than a foul-smelling bathroom. Blocked drains pipes can trigger bacteria to build up, resulting in pungent odors. You can put warm water and bleach down the drain to eliminate a few of the bad smells, however that is only a temporary fix.

3. Identify Underlying Issues
When you tidy your drain once a month, you can identify underlying issues prior to they end up being major issues. If it is not simply the typical hair and gunk, you ought to contact a plumbing professional to see if your restroom drains pipes need to be repaired.

4. Faster Draining
Do you hate the sensation of standing in a number of inches of water in the shower? A slow-draining sink or shower is a great sign that you require to clean up the pipes. When you tidy your drains pipes monthly, you ought to never ever have to worry about slow-draining sinks or showers. Not just that, but faster-draining pipelines help keep your sink and shower cleaner.

5. Avoid Extensive Damage
As discussed, frequently cleaning your restroom drains can assist recognize underlying problems that are more severe than a sink clogged with hair. The average cost to repair a drain line is $696, which is much more costly than the mere $10 it requires to clean your drains pipes month-to-month. Severe obstructions can damage your entire pipes system and even have an effect on the public systems and the quality of water.

Ensure overflow holes are cleaned out. This can help to prevent any water damage. Overflow holes are a method to stop water from overflowing if a sink is left on by accident. If the overflow hole is obstructed it will not be able to do its job.

If you have a gas hot water heater, you must regularly check the pilot burner for excessive soot buildup. Extreme soot buildup can trigger a stopped up flue, which can lead to carbon monoxide dripping into your house. Thus, a routine check up of the pilot burner is really essential in making certain there isn't a accumulation of soot.

Make certain that you prevent throwing fats down the drain after you tidy up your meal. Fats can solidify with time which can cause a drainage problem and corrupt your water flow. Toss out fats and different kinds of cooking oils in the trash after you finish with your meal.

To get rid of dirt that accumulates under the edges of faucets, think about using an old tooth brush, rather than cleaning items. Numerous cleansing items will just trigger damage to your faucets, and a few of this damage could be serious. Simply dip the toothbrush into warm water and after that utilize it.

Waste disposal unit are a common reason for pipes problems, which is an simple problem to solve. Do not just put everything down the disposal or treat it like a 2nd trash bin. Use the disposal things that would be hard to deal with typically. Putting all remaining food down the sink is a great way to produce clogs.

Ensure to never leave any combustible liquids near your water heater. Specific liquids like gasoline, solvents, or adhesives are combustible, and if left too close to the hot water heater, can ignite. Place it far away from your water heater if you have to have these liquids in your basement.
